Preparing the Bathtub Surface
Proper preparation is critical to the success of bathtub resurfacing. Begin by thoroughly cleaning the tub to remove soap scum, oils, and any residues that could prevent adhesion of the new finish. Use a heavy-duty cleaner or a degreasing agent specifically formulated for bathroom surfaces. Avoid products that leave a film, such as wax-based cleaners.
After cleaning, inspect the bathtub for chips, cracks, or rust spots. These imperfections must be repaired before applying any resurfacing materials. Use a high-quality epoxy putty or a two-part filler designed for bathtubs to fill in damaged areas. Once applied, sand the repairs smooth to blend seamlessly with the surrounding surface.
Next, sand the entire tub using fine-grit sandpaper (around 400 grit) to create a slightly rough texture. This step improves the adhesion of the primer and resurfacing coatings. Always wear a mask and goggles to protect yourself from dust particles during sanding. After sanding, thoroughly rinse the tub to remove all dust and debris, and allow it to dry completely.
Before proceeding, ensure the bathroom is well-ventilated and that all water sources are turned off. Cover any fixtures, drains, and surrounding areas with painter’s tape and plastic sheeting to protect them from overspray or drips.
Applying Primer and Resurfacing Coating
Once the surface is clean, dry, and prepped, the next step is applying a bonding primer. The primer creates a strong base for the topcoat, enhancing durability and adhesion. Use a primer specifically formulated for fiberglass, acrylic, or porcelain tubs, depending on your tub material.
Apply the primer evenly using a high-density foam roller or a spray gun for a smooth finish. Avoid thick layers; thin, uniform coats work best. Allow the primer to cure fully according to the manufacturer’s instructions, typically for 2 to 4 hours.
After the primer has dried, mix the resurfacing coating components carefully if using a two-part epoxy or acrylic kit. Follow the manufacturer’s mixing ratios precisely to ensure proper curing and finish quality. Apply the coating with a foam roller or spray gun, using long, even strokes to avoid streaks and bubbles.
It is common to apply two to three thin coats of the resurfacing product, allowing proper drying time between each layer. Lightly sand between coats with ultra-fine sandpaper (600 grit or higher) to maintain smoothness and remove any imperfections.
Drying and Curing Times
Drying and curing times vary depending on the product used, ambient temperature, and humidity. Proper curing is essential for the resurfaced bathtub to withstand daily use and cleaning chemicals.
| Step | Typical Drying Time | Recommended Curing Time | Notes |
|---|---|---|---|
| Primer Application | 1–2 hours | 2–4 hours | Ensure surface is tack-free before next coat |
| First Resurfacing Coat | 2–4 hours | 24 hours | Light sanding recommended before next coat |
| Second Resurfacing Coat | 2–4 hours | 24 hours | Final sanding if needed for smooth finish |
| Final Cure | — | 3–7 days | No water contact during this period |
Maintain good ventilation throughout the drying and curing process to help evaporate solvents and speed curing times. Avoid temperature extremes, as very cold or hot conditions can affect drying and the integrity of the finish.
Safety Precautions and Tools Needed
Resurfacing a bathtub involves chemicals that can be hazardous if not handled properly. Always take necessary safety precautions to protect yourself and your surroundings.
- Wear a respirator mask rated for organic vapors to avoid inhaling fumes.
- Use chemical-resistant gloves and eye protection.
- Ensure the workspace is well-ventilated; open windows and use fans if possible.
- Keep children and pets away from the work area.
- Have clean water and soap nearby in case of accidental skin contact.
Essential tools and materials for bathtub resurfacing include:
- Heavy-duty cleaner or degreaser
- Epoxy putty or filler for repairs
- Fine and ultra-fine grit sandpaper (400 and 600+ grit)
- High-density foam rollers or spray gun
- Painter’s tape and plastic sheeting
- Respirator mask, gloves, goggles
- Resurfacing kit (primer and topcoat)

Preparing the Bathtub Surface for Resurfacing
Proper preparation of the bathtub surface is essential to ensure a durable, smooth finish when resurfacing. The process involves cleaning, repairing, and sanding the tub to create an optimal bonding surface for the new coating.
Step-by-step preparation process:
- Remove any caulking and fixtures: Use a utility knife or scraper to carefully remove old caulk around the tub edges. Detach drain covers, overflow plates, and faucet handles if needed to allow full access to the surface.
- Clean thoroughly: Apply a strong, non-abrasive cleaner such as a trisodium phosphate (TSP) solution to eliminate soap scum, oils, and mildew. Scrub with a nylon brush, then rinse completely with water. Repeat cleaning if any residue remains.
- Repair chips and cracks: Inspect for any surface damage. Use a two-part epoxy filler or bathtub repair kit to fill chips, cracks, or gouges. Smooth the repair compound with a putty knife, then allow it to cure fully according to the manufacturer’s instructions.
- Sand the surface: Sand the entire tub using 220- to 320-grit sandpaper or a sanding block. This step removes the glossy finish and creates a slightly rough texture that promotes adhesion of the resurfacing material. Be sure to sand evenly to avoid uneven surfaces.
- Remove sanding dust: Wipe the tub with a damp cloth or tack cloth to remove all dust particles. Allow the surface to dry completely before proceeding to the next step.
Tools and materials checklist for preparation:
| Tool/Material | Purpose |
|---|---|
| Utility knife or scraper | Remove old caulk and fixtures |
| Trisodium phosphate (TSP) or equivalent cleaner | Deep cleaning to remove oils and residues |
| Nylon brush | Scrubbing the surface without scratching |
| Two-part epoxy filler or repair kit | Filling chips, cracks, and gouges |
| 220-320 grit sandpaper or sanding block | Sanding the surface to promote adhesion |
| Cloths (damp and tack cloth) | Removing dust and drying the surface |
Applying the Resurfacing Coating
After thorough preparation, the next phase is applying the resurfacing coating. This process requires precision and attention to environmental conditions to achieve a professional finish.
Recommended materials for resurfacing:
- Bathtub refinishing kit: Typically includes bonding agent, primer, and topcoat (usually epoxy or polyurethane-based).
- Protective gear: Respirator mask, gloves, and safety goggles to protect against fumes and skin contact.
- Application tools: High-density foam rollers, fine bristle brushes, and spray equipment if available.
Step-by-step application process:
- Ventilate the workspace: Open windows and use fans to ensure adequate airflow. Resurfacing products emit strong fumes that require proper ventilation.
- Apply bonding agent: Using a foam roller or brush, apply the bonding agent evenly over the entire tub surface. This layer enhances the adhesion between the tub and subsequent coatings. Allow it to dry as per product instructions.
- Apply primer coat: Once the bonding agent is dry, apply a thin, even primer layer. The primer seals the surface and prepares it for the topcoat. Avoid drips or pooling, which can cause uneven curing.
- Apply topcoat(s): After the primer has dried, apply the topcoat using a clean foam roller or spray gun for the smoothest finish. Multiple thin coats are preferable to one thick coat. Allow each coat to dry thoroughly before applying the next.
- Final curing: Follow the manufacturer’s recommended curing time, typically 24 to 72 hours, before using the bathtub. Avoid moisture, heavy use, or cleaning during this period to ensure proper hardening.
Tips for optimal results:
- Maintain a consistent temperature and humidity level during application and curing, ideally between 65°F and 85°F with low humidity.
- Work systematically from one end of the tub to the other to avoid overlap marks.
- Use light pressure with rollers to minimize air bubbles and texture.

Frequently Asked Questions (FAQs)
What tools and materials are needed to resurface a bathtub?
You will need sandpaper or a sanding block, a cleaning agent, a putty knife, epoxy or acrylic resurfacing kit, painter’s tape, protective gloves, and a respirator mask for safety.How long does the bathtub resurfacing process typically take?
The entire process usually takes 3 to 4 hours, including cleaning, sanding, applying the resurfacing material, and curing time. Full curing may require up to 24 hours before use.Can I resurface a bathtub myself, or should I hire a professional?
DIY resurfacing is possible for those with patience and attention to detail. However, professionals ensure a more durable and flawless finish, especially for damaged or heavily worn tubs.Is bathtub resurfacing a permanent solution?
Resurfacing provides a durable, attractive finish that can last 10 to 15 years with proper care, but it is not as permanent as replacing the tub entirely.What are the common mistakes to avoid when resurfacing a bathtub?
Avoid insufficient cleaning, inadequate sanding, applying resurfacing material too thickly or unevenly, and neglecting proper ventilation during the process.How should I maintain a resurfaced bathtub to prolong its lifespan?
Use non-abrasive cleaners, avoid harsh chemicals, clean regularly, and prevent standing water to maintain the surface integrity and appearance.
